    Devon Walker's journey to the NFL has not been a conventional one. In September 2012, the Tulane safety suffered a spinal cord injury after he collided with a teammate during his university's game against Tulsa, leaving him paralyzed from the neck down. After months of hospitalization and extensive rehabilitation, Walker returned to Tulane in the fall of 2013 to rejoin his team on the sidelines and finish out his senior year. His ardent support served as motivation and inspiration to both his Green Wave teammates and the community as a whole, and Walker was given the 2013 Disney Spirit Award...

    Harvard researcher Karen King today unveiled an ancient papyrus fragment with the phrase, “Jesus said to them, ‘My wife.’” The text also mentions “Mary,” arguably a reference to Mary Magdalene. The announcement at an academic conference in Rome is sure to send shock waves through the Christian world.
